Product Introduction

Overview

The BC817-40LT3 is a general-purpose NPN bipolar transistor manufactured by onsemi. It is designed for use in both linear and switching applications, making it versatile for a wide range of electronic circuits. The transistor is housed in the SOT-23 package, which is ideal for lower power surface mount applications. This device is Pb-Free, Halogen Free/BFR Free, and fully RoHS compliant, ensuring environmental sustainability and compliance with regulatory standards.

Key Specifications

Characteristic Symbol Value Unit
Collector-Emitter Voltage VCEO 45 V
Collector-Base Voltage VCBO 50 V
Emitter-Base Voltage VEBO 5.0 V
Collector Current - Continuous IC 500 mA mAdc
DC Current Gain (hFE) hFE 250 - 600 -
Collector-Emitter Saturation Voltage VCE(sat) 0.7 V V
Base-Emitter On Voltage VBE(on) 1.2 V V
Power Dissipation PD 310 mW mW
Thermal Resistance, Junction to Ambient RθJA 403 °C/W °C/W
Operating and Storage Temperature Range TJ, TSTG -65 to +150 °C °C

Key Features

  • Ideally suited for automatic insertion and surface mount applications.
  • Epitaxial planar die construction for improved performance.
  • Complementary PNP types available (BC807).
  • Totally lead-free and fully RoHS compliant.
  • Halogen and antimony free, making it a 'green' device.
  • Qualified to AEC-Q101 standards for high reliability in automotive applications.
  • Pb-Free package and solderable leads.
  • UL flammability classification rating 94V-0.

Applications

  • Linear and switching applications.
  • Steering logic and switching circuits.
  • Automotive control units.
  • Consumer electronics.
  • Audio frequency (AF) amplifier applications.
